Output 5244844a32fe26261fe33c42034f79faf4014ac0c0ca741c7a5ced8020cc0274:2

value
46423377
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8ddfa88a97373aa2927371e57068c7df9dcb0be OP_EQUAL
address
MWb3jMJvBXW8Ky4PeLN8K3PLnzHGzSDsqC
transaction
5244844a32fe26261fe33c42034f79faf4014ac0c0ca741c7a5ced8020cc0274
spent
true